Historically, the commode has its roots in the necessity for sanitation and convenience. The earliest types were simple wooden structures used in homes before the advent of indoor plumbing. As society progressed, so did the need for more efficient and hygienic solutions. The introduction of the flush toilet in the late 19th century marked a significant turning point, transforming the commode from a basic utility to a refined fixture in modern bathrooms.

Moreover, the materials used in the construction of commodes have advanced remarkably. Modern toilets are often made from high-quality ceramics that are sleek and easy to clean, reducing maintenance time and enhancing sanitation. The introduction of comfort height toilets, which are slightly taller than traditional models, has further improved comfort by providing a more natural seating position that can reduce the risk of falls and injury for older adults.

In addition to ergonomics, many modern commodes come equipped with innovative features such as bidets or integrated washing systems. These enhancements not only raise the bar for comfort but also emphasize the importance of personal hygiene. Bidets offer a cleaning solution that is more thorough and gentle than traditional toilet paper, significantly improving cleanliness and comfort for users. This is especially beneficial for those with sensitive skin or specific medical conditions that require a gentler approach to hygiene.


Another remarkable innovation in the realm of commodes is the move towards smart toilets. These high-tech solutions come equipped with various functionalities, including heated seats, automatic lid opening and closing, and adjustable water temperature and pressure for bidet functions. Smart commodes provide a level of luxury that redefines personal hygiene, making the experience not just comfortable but also enjoyable. With features such as self-cleaning functions, these toilets not only enhance user comfort but also promote a more hygienic bathroom environment.
